Old Tv & Sky

My parents are pensioners they can't work modern tv's. My dad has a really old tv and sky box that has worked for years anyway his tv finally packed up and I got him another old tv from gumtree. I plugged the scart lead into it from the sky box and found sky but its on channel 99 

When I switch the tv off it doesn't automatically switch back on to channel 99 for sky tv how do I get this to happen?

    Thinking back to the olden days, when TVs still came with SCART sockets, they would normally automatically switch over to the SCART input whenever a set-top box was switched on.

    Check that there isn't some odd setting in the TV's set up menu that disables that.

    If the TV has HDMI, then that may work better.  And the picture quality could be better too.
